Jewish Federation Releases Independent Committee Report On $6.3 Million Victims of Terror Fund Proceeds

Tuesday, March 5, 2019
Posted in ,

The Independent Committee formed to oversee the distribution of the Victims of Terror funds has concluded its work and will begin to distribute the money, $6,302,803 in total.
